Beecher B. Lemmon (June 8, 1893 - Feb. 12, 1985)
--
Beecher B. Lemmon, 91, Lafayette, formerly of Pleasant Lake, died at 2:25 a.m. Tuesday
in the Indiana Veteran's Home Hospital, Lafayette.
He was born on June 8, 1893, in Pleasant Lake to Maurice and Anna Lemmon. He graduated
from Pleasant Lake High School and Valpairaso College.
Mr. Beecher was preceded in death by his first wife, Erma White Lemmon, in 1912 and his
second wife, Helen Hubka Lemmon, in 1923.
He is survived by his wife, Madalene C. Nichols Lemmon, whom he married in 1928 in
Auburn; three sons, Arthur Lemmon and Jack Lemmon, both of Lafayette; and Russell Lemmon,
San Jose, Calif.; two daughters, Mrs. William (Coyene) Halpern, Arlington, Va.; and Mrs.
Brad (Carlyle) Pare, Richmond, Mich.; and eight grandchildren.
Mr. Lemmon was a well known chef in the Lafayette area, where he had been a resident the
past 40 years.
Memorial services will be held at 10 a.m., Saturday at Hippensteel Funeral Home,
Lafayette, with the Rev. Larry Johnson officiating. Graveside services, with Weicht
Funeral Home in charge, will be held later in the year at Pleasant Lake Cemetery.
Memorials are to the Cancer Fund.
